SQL Server优化器:实现最佳性能(sqlserver优化器)
SQL Server优化器是一种有用的技术工具,它有助于优化数据库性能,从而实现最佳性能。它作为SQL Server引擎的一部分存在,并且在查询运行期间以隐式方式运行。它的主要目的是创建最有效的查询执行计划,该计划有助于快速运行查询以生成有用的结果。
SQL Server优化器的主要功能是根据用户提交的查询结构对查询的执行计划进行分析,以便产生尽可能有效和快速的计划。它以各种方式使用索引,它还可以重新排列运算符,更改查询表表达式或使用暴力力学优化计划。
SQL Server优化器还可以帮助用户充分利用现有的索引和存储过程。通过使用可读性强的特殊性指令,查询可以更容易地提供准确的结果。此外,它可以确保数据库能够支持不断变化的业务需求,这是获得和保持最佳性能的关键。
通过使用SQL Server优化器,用户可以从获得更高性能中受益。该优化器还可以帮助用户消除拖慢性能和数据库繁琐性的问题。例如,它可以消除过度使用内置索引,以及对分析和不常使用的报表查询进行有效编码的需求。
SQL Server优化器可以通过以下操作获取,从而实现最佳性能:
1、执行诊断分析以识别拖慢性能的查询执行计划,以及为这些查询提供改进建议;
2、使用SQL调整器优化器框架优化建议;
3、对系统设置进行调优,以确认查询是否是最佳性能;
4、使用特定指令转换查询执行计划;
5、监视系统状态,以识别有效的数据库操作;
6、使用有效的存储过程,以避免在多个查询中重复计算或处理;
7、使用SQL指令优化参数和系统变量以提供更好的性能。
总的来说,使用SQL Server优化器,可以改善数据库系统的性能,而不会破坏任何现有数据或应用程序。通过获得有效的数据库查询并最大限度地利用现有索引和存储过程,SQL Server优化器可以帮助用户实现最佳性能。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 SQL Server优化器:实现最佳性能(sqlserver优化器)
相关文章
- 让SQL Server更有效利用缓存表(sqlserver缓存表)
- SQL Server汉化:实现多语言界面的简易指南(sqlserver汉化)
- SQL Server中表的分区设计(sqlserver表分区)
- SQL Server培训:深耕后端的必修课(sqlserver培训)
- 查询SQL Server实现关联查询的技巧(sqlserver关联)
- SQL Server自增长:简单易懂的实现方式(sqlserver自增长)
- SQL Server 实现代码换行的技巧(sqlserver换行)
- 玩转SQL Server之爆破终端(爆破sqlserver)
- 数据库收缩SQLServer 数据库,提升空间使用率(收缩sqlserver)
- 慕课网:学习SQL Server,让你的技能更上一层楼(慕课网sqlserver)
- SQL Server 简答题:容易和困难的问题及解决方案(sqlserver简答题)
- SQL Server立方体:探索多维数据存储世界(sqlserver立方体)
- 求出SQL Server数据库占比情况(sqlserver求占比)
- 用SQL Server标准版激活企业数据库之路(sqlserver标准版)
- SQLServer控件:满足不同编程需求(sqlserver控件)
- 基于SQL Server的排课系统构建(sqlserver排课)
- 份查询SQL Server中查找当前年份的简便方法(sqlserver当前年)
- 是数据库中心SQL Server:让电脑成为数据库核心(sqlserver对电脑)
- SQL Server行数不尽相同(sqlserver多少行)
- 回收让SQL Server垃圾回收带来的收益(sqlserver垃圾)
- 利用SQL Server实现数据表同步(sqlserver同步表)
- SQL Server 中的「括号」使用技巧(sqlserver中括号)
- SQL Server中排序有效解决方案(sqlserver中排序)
- 的登录管理SQL Server中sa用户的登录权限管理(sqlserver中sa)
- SQL Server表:最佳数据存储方式(表sqlserver)